NEW YORK, N.Y. – CNN’s new morning show will be called “New Day” and it will start on June 10.
The network had previously announced that Chris Cuomo and Kate Balduan (BALD’-winn) would be CNN’s new morning hosts. On Tuesday, the network gave their show a name and a start date.
Jim Murphy, who used to run “Good Morning America” at ABC, is the senior executive producer who will run “New Day.”
The morning show is an early attempt by new CNN boss Jeff Zucker to put his stamp on the network. Before moving up the corporate ladder at NBC, Zucker was executive producer of the “Today” show.
